## Logistics Transition — Dunwell to Arkette (Managers Only)

This page documents the planned migration from Dunwell Haulage to Arkette Logistics. Finance should note the revised cost structure: per-pallet pricing replaces the flat monthly retainer, with an estimated nine percent annual saving at current volumes. Early-termination fees with Dunwell have been negotiated down and will be expensed this quarter. Invoice routing changes take effect at cutover. The underlying strategic intent is recorded below.

board note of kageg-bahof: The renewal with Holwynax Holdings closes at $2 million a year, 5 percent below the last contract. Project Ulaath slips by two quarters because of the supplier delay.

Provenance notes for the Ferrowick FD-leak hunt. Every instrumented build is produced from a tagged commit by the sealed Ashgate runner; no local builds are admissible evidence. If you capture a leak, record the kernel version and the runner's attestation. Match your binary to the build token shown below before filing anything.

build token for bajep-yahig: htk31_df314b3f96d6df87012242ee10fda56

Handover: SQL linting (for eng sync)

Taking over sqlint rules from Petra. Current state: naming and keyword-case rules enforced in CI; join-style rule is warn-only until the Oakmere repo is cleaned up. Two flaky rules disabled, tracked in the backlog. Pre-commit hook is optional for now. The linter currently runs with these settings.

settings of tagef-bawif:
DRUIX_HOST=druix.zemvarlabs.internal
DRUIX_PORT=8000

### Account Recovery — Gatefold Canary Gating

If the canary gate account locks out during a rollout, deploys freeze at 5% traffic. Do not force-promote. Verify gating rules are intact in the Gatefold console, then initiate account recovery from the ops bastion. Recovery prompts for two confirmations, then a passphrase. Resume the canary only after error budgets reset. The recovery passphrase is as follows.

strongbox words: zorwyn-sorael-belion-ulaius-silmir-ulays-briax-rusdor-gorix